I'm not really sure what you mean? If you create an indicator you can call it directly in a strategy and you can also create your own library of custom functions/methods to call(user defined methods in the indicator lib).
To me its just a matter of time, it seems like anything can be done but its just a matter of waiting for Ninja to impliment it directly if you don'twant to roll your own work around in c sharp. 7.0 is sopposed to be out at the end of the year and sounds amazing, multi instrument stuff for plotting several series on the same chart in the same window, historic bid/ask..Seems like 7.0 is when it should really come of age.

I think the issue is that the indicator lib and the strategy lib are SEPARATE.
If I write a method/function for an indicator, it must be COPIED to the strategy lib if I need to use it in a strategy.
I've checked with tech support on this and they are aware of it.
Probably will be fixed in 7.0.
In the meantime, it's just an inconvenience.

I really doubt they are going to change this.I really don't see how its less convient and if anything it makes things more modular.
You maintain your indicators and then call them within a strategy..if you figure out down the line a better way to do indicator X, updating every strategy that uses indicator X is nothing more than changing indicator X one time, viola.
There is nothing stopping you from writing everything in strategies though and you would have what you want, but like i said that would seem more of a pain IMO.
